N'Golo Kante set for PSG move?

12 June 2018 - 07:46

Chelsea midfielder N'Golo Kante could be set for a mega-money move to French club PSG. The Ligue 1 champions are expected to make a 75 million euro bid for the Frenchman.

  • Kante, who helped Leicester City to their first ever Premier League title and then moved to Chelsea the following year; with whom he won his second championship in England, is widely regarded as one of the finest defensive midfielders in the world.

    Paris St Germain have been locked in talks with Blues representatives for over a month regarding a potential move, with the club's manager Thomas Tuchel insisting that Kante would be the perfect acquisition for the club.

    PSG's board have one target in mind - winning the Champions League - and it is believed that signing Kante and partnering him in midfield with Marco Verratti would give the team a realistic chance of winning the European Cup.

    Chelsea owner Roman Abramovich has reportedly told his club's board that he would like to keep Kante, but it appears the player is ready to move abroad.
